You can buy the most ergonomic chair on the market, set your monitor at eye level, and stand for an hour every afternoon. But if your keyboard sits on the desk surface, your wrists are still bending at an angle that causes strain over an 8-hour day. An ergonomic keyboard tray solves this by positioning your keyboard at the correct height — slightly below your elbow level — so your forearms stay parallel to the floor and your wrists remain straight. Best All-in-One Printer Scanner for Home Office 2025: Inkjet & Laser Reviewed

I have a theory about printers: the worst part isn’t the purchase, it’s what comes after. You buy a printer for $70, and six months later you’ve spent $120 on ink cartridges the printer refuses to recognize because the chip says they’re low, even though there’s clearly ink left. The right printer is the one where the running costs don’t silently drain your budget. The home office printer market splits cleanly into two camps. Traditional inkjets are cheap upfront but expensive per page — best for people who print photos or print infrequently (ink dries out if unused for weeks). Laser printers cost more upfront but print for pennies per page, so they’re the better choice for anyone printing more than 50 pages per month. Best Acoustic Panels for Home Offices of 2025: Complete Buying Guide

If you’ve ever been on a Zoom call that sounded like you were broadcasting from a bathroom, you know the problem. Hard surfaces — walls, desks, floors, windows — reflect sound. Your voice bounces around, comes back at the microphone a few milliseconds later, and the result is that hollow, echoey, “I’m definitely working from home” quality that everyone on the call can hear but nobody mentions. Acoustic panels fix this. They absorb sound rather than reflecting it, which means less echo, less reverb, and a voice that sounds clear and present rather than distant and cavernous.
